Explanation

High-risk human papillomavirus oncoproteins E6 and E7 cooperate to drive cervical carcinogenesis. E7 binds and inactivates Rb, releasing E2F and promoting cell-cycle progression. E6 recruits the ubiquitin ligase E6AP to target p53 for degradation, thereby disabling the apoptotic and checkpoint responses that would otherwise eliminate the proliferating infected cell. The combined action removes both major tumor-suppressor barriers.
